In May 2025, merrell.com reported a revenue of $15,236,639 with 116,897 transactions and 4,285,326 sessions. The average order value (AOV) was between $125-150, and the conversion rate fell between 2.50-3.00%. Compared to its competitors, merrell.com outperformed sectionhiker.com in terms of revenue, transactions, sessions, and conversion rate. However, sectionhiker.com had a higher AOV range of $250-275. holabirdsports.com generated $765,871 in revenue with 4,905 transactions and 333,827 sessions, boasting a slightly higher AOV of $150-175 and a conversion rate of 1.00-1.50%. theshoemart.com and sierra.com both had lower revenues than merrell.com, with AOVs ranging from $350-375 and $175-200 respectively. ems.com fell behind merrell.com in terms of revenue and sessions, but had a higher AOV range of $225-250 and a similar conversion rate of 2.00-2.50%.
